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$104.35 | 9.560% | $114.3259 | $114.33 | $114.35 | $114.30 |
Purchase #2 | $194.85 | 5.108% | $204.8029 | $204.80 | $204.80 | $204.80 |
Purchase #3 | $89.51 | 5.778% | $94.6819 | $94.68 | $94.70 | $94.70 |
Purchase #4 | $31.98 | 10.611% | $35.3734 | $35.37 | $35.35 | $35.40 |
Purchase #5 | $119.78 | 3.681% | $124.1891 | $124.19 | $124.20 | $124.20 |
Purchase #6 | $47.47 | 8.495% | $51.5026 | $51.50 | $51.50 | $51.50 |
Purchase #7 | $183.59 | 10.236% | $202.3823 | $202.38 | $202.40 | $202.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$771.53 | $827.2581 | $827.25 | $827.30 | $827.30 |
